The forecast for the import of cocoa preparations for beverages into France shows a steady increase from 2024 to 2028, starting at 17.448 million kilograms and reaching 18.27 million kilograms. The annual growth rate approximates 1.3%, reflecting a stable demand uplift in the French market. In 2023, the import stood around 17.239 million kilograms, setting the stage for these gradual increases.
Future trends to monitor include:
- Consumption shifts driven by health trends, favoring products with lower sugar content or organic certifications.
- Potential impacts from trade policies, tariffs, and supply chain disruptions related to global cocoa production.
- Innovation in beverage offerings, which could further stimulate imports in this segment.
